The plan was:

1. A GOOD soak down with the hose.
2. Wash with Megs NXT
3. Clay the car with a mixture of gold class and water in a spray bottle.
4. Wash the car again with Megs Gold class
5. Attack the worst area's with the PC.
Due to time restrictions we only got to do 75% of the car with a SRX1 pad using Megs #83 I would have liked to have followed this up with #80 on a SFX2 pad and some kind of LSP. But it looks like this will be in another session.
6. AG Bumpercare
7. Megs tyre gel.
